首頁(yè) - 網(wǎng)校 - 萬(wàn)題庫(kù) - 美好明天 - 直播 - 導(dǎo)航
您現(xiàn)在的位置: 考試吧 > 自學(xué)考試 > 復(fù)習(xí)指導(dǎo) > 工學(xué)類 > 正文
設(shè)備管理   一、輸入輸出操作(要求達(dá)到“識(shí)記”層次)  1、什么是輸入輸出操作:主存儲(chǔ)器與外圍設(shè)備之間的信息傳送操作稱為輸入輸出操作! 2、對(duì)于存儲(chǔ)型設(shè)備,輸入輸出操作的信息傳輸單位為“塊”。對(duì)輸……
 設(shè)備管理

  一、輸入輸出操作(要求達(dá)到“識(shí)記”層次)

  1、什么是輸入輸出操作:主存儲(chǔ)器與外圍設(shè)備之間的信息傳送操作稱為輸入輸出操作。

  2、對(duì)于存儲(chǔ)型設(shè)備,輸入輸出操作的信息傳輸單位為“塊”。對(duì)輸入輸出型設(shè)備,輸入輸出操作的信息傳輸單位為“字符”。

  二、獨(dú)占設(shè)備和共享設(shè)備(識(shí)記)

  1、獨(dú)占設(shè)備是指每次只能供一個(gè)作業(yè)執(zhí)行期間單獨(dú)使用的設(shè)備。如輸入機(jī)、磁帶機(jī)、打印機(jī)等。

  2、共享設(shè)備是指允許幾個(gè)作業(yè)執(zhí)行期間可同時(shí)使用的設(shè)備。共享設(shè)備的“同時(shí)使用”的含義是指多個(gè)作業(yè)可以交替啟動(dòng)共享設(shè)備,其實(shí)是當(dāng)一個(gè)用業(yè)正在使用設(shè)備時(shí)其他作業(yè)暫不能使用,即每一時(shí)刻仍只有一個(gè)作業(yè)占用,但當(dāng)一個(gè)作業(yè)正在使用設(shè)備時(shí)其他作業(yè)就可使用。

  三、獨(dú)占設(shè)備的分配(領(lǐng)會(huì))

  1、獨(dú)占設(shè)備的絕對(duì)號(hào)與相對(duì)號(hào)

  這和絕對(duì)地址/相對(duì)地址的概念類似。絕對(duì)號(hào)就是將每一臺(tái)設(shè)備確定一個(gè)編號(hào)(相當(dāng)于一個(gè)絕對(duì)地址)。相對(duì)號(hào)就是為了用戶程序的方便而設(shè)的,在用戶請(qǐng)求使用時(shí),采用“設(shè)備類-相對(duì)號(hào)”來(lái)提出使用設(shè)備要求。由系統(tǒng)建立絕對(duì)號(hào)與“設(shè)備類-相對(duì)號(hào)”之間的關(guān)系,就能正確啟用設(shè)備了。

  2、設(shè)備的指定方式

  1) 設(shè)備絕對(duì)號(hào):系統(tǒng)為每一個(gè)設(shè)備確定一個(gè)唯一的編號(hào)。

  2)設(shè)備相對(duì)號(hào):不具體指定是哪臺(tái)設(shè)備,只說(shuō)明要某類設(shè)備多少臺(tái),這樣可以由系統(tǒng)靈活分配。

  3)設(shè)備獨(dú)立性:采用“設(shè)備類、相對(duì)號(hào)”方式使用設(shè)備時(shí),用戶編程時(shí)使用的設(shè)備與實(shí)際使用哪臺(tái)設(shè)備無(wú)關(guān),這就是“設(shè)備獨(dú)立性”。

  4)如何實(shí)現(xiàn)獨(dú)占性設(shè)備分配:對(duì)于獨(dú)占性設(shè)備,系統(tǒng)采用“靜態(tài)分配”的策略,就是當(dāng)一個(gè)作業(yè)所需使用的獨(dú)占設(shè)備能得到滿足時(shí),該作業(yè)才能被裝入主存儲(chǔ)器執(zhí)行。

  在操作系統(tǒng)中,設(shè)置“設(shè)備分配表”來(lái)記錄計(jì)算機(jī)系統(tǒng)所配置的獨(dú)占設(shè)備類型、臺(tái)數(shù)和分配情況等。設(shè)備分配表由“設(shè)備類表”和“設(shè)備表”兩部分組成。通過(guò)查表和修改表的操作完成設(shè)備分配工作。

  四、磁盤的驅(qū)動(dòng)調(diào)度(領(lǐng)會(huì))

  1、 磁盤的結(jié)構(gòu)

  還記得小學(xué)時(shí)的作業(yè)嗎?秒,分,小時(shí)?)這也一樣,扇區(qū)套在磁道里,磁道套在柱面里,柱面套在一個(gè)磁盤里。接下來(lái)的問(wèn)題就是被除數(shù)=除數(shù)×商+余數(shù)了。明白了嗎?

  2、訪問(wèn)磁盤的操作時(shí)間

  3、磁盤的驅(qū)動(dòng)調(diào)度:系統(tǒng)決定等待磁盤訪問(wèn)者的執(zhí)行次序的工作就是磁盤的“驅(qū)動(dòng)調(diào)度”。

  4、對(duì)磁盤進(jìn)行驅(qū)動(dòng)調(diào)度的目的:有利于系統(tǒng)效率的提高。

  5、磁盤調(diào)度分為移臂調(diào)度和旋轉(zhuǎn)調(diào)度。

  6、移臂調(diào)度算法包括以下四種:

  1) 先來(lái)先服務(wù)算法;

  根據(jù)訪問(wèn)者提出訪問(wèn)請(qǐng)求的先后次序來(lái)決定執(zhí)行次序。

  2) 最短尋找時(shí)間優(yōu)先調(diào)度算法;

  從等待的訪問(wèn)者中挑選尋找時(shí)間最短的那個(gè)請(qǐng)求執(zhí)行,而不管訪問(wèn)者的先后次序。

  3) 電梯調(diào)度算法;

  從移動(dòng)臂當(dāng)前位置沿移動(dòng)方向選擇最近的那個(gè)柱面的訪問(wèn)者來(lái)執(zhí)行,若該方向上無(wú)請(qǐng)求訪問(wèn)時(shí),就改變移動(dòng)方向再選擇。

  4) 單向掃描調(diào)度算法。

  從0柱面開始往里單向掃描,掃到哪個(gè)執(zhí)行哪個(gè)。

  7、信息的優(yōu)化分布:知道信息在磁盤上排列不一定是按順序最優(yōu),對(duì)于一些能預(yù)知處理要求的信息采用優(yōu)化分頁(yè)可以縮短輸入輸出操作時(shí)間,提高系統(tǒng)效率。

  五、外圍設(shè)備的啟動(dòng)(識(shí)記)

  1、通道(channel):計(jì)算機(jī)系統(tǒng)中能夠獨(dú)立完成輸入輸出操作的硬件裝置。是CPU與設(shè)備的橋梁。

  注解:CPU并不直接操作外圍設(shè)備,他連接通道(I/O處理機(jī)),通道連接設(shè)備控制器,設(shè)備控制器連接設(shè)備。CPU只需把“I/O”設(shè)備啟動(dòng),并給出相關(guān)的操作要求。然后就由通道來(lái)處理輸入輸出事宜,做完后報(bào)告CPU。

  2、通道地址字(CAW)和通道狀態(tài)字(CSW)

  用來(lái)存放通道程序首地址的主存固定單元稱為“通道地址字”。

  通道狀態(tài)字:用于記錄通道和設(shè)備執(zhí)行情況的主存單元。

  3、I/O中斷:是指中央處理器和通道協(xié)調(diào)工作的一種手段。通道借助I/O中斷請(qǐng)求CPU進(jìn)行干預(yù),CPU根據(jù)產(chǎn)生的I/O中斷事件了解輸入輸出操作的執(zhí)行情況,I/O中斷事件是由于通道程序的執(zhí)行或其他外界原因引起的,對(duì)通道操作而言,當(dāng)操作正常結(jié)束或異常結(jié)束(如設(shè)備故障、設(shè)備特殊情況引起異常結(jié)束)形成I/O中斷,由CPU根據(jù)相應(yīng)情況分別處理。

  六、虛擬設(shè)備SPOOL系統(tǒng)(領(lǐng)會(huì))

  1、實(shí)現(xiàn)虛擬設(shè)備的目的:用一種物理設(shè)備模擬另一類物理設(shè)備,使各作業(yè)在執(zhí)行期間只使用虛擬的設(shè)備而不直接使用物理的獨(dú)占設(shè)備。這種技術(shù)可使獨(dú)占的設(shè)備變成可共享的設(shè)備,使得設(shè)備的利用率和系統(tǒng)效率都能得到提高。

  2、實(shí)現(xiàn)虛擬設(shè)備的硬件條件:大容量磁盤;中斷裝置和通道;中央處理器與通道并行工作的能力。

  實(shí)現(xiàn)虛擬設(shè)備的軟件條件是要求操作系統(tǒng)采用多道程序設(shè)計(jì)技術(shù)。

  3、虛擬設(shè)備的實(shí)現(xiàn)原理:對(duì)于多道程序,輸入時(shí)將一批作業(yè)的信息通過(guò)輸入設(shè)備預(yù)先傳送到磁盤上。輸出時(shí)將作業(yè)產(chǎn)生的結(jié)果也全部暫時(shí)存在磁盤上而不直接輸出,直到一個(gè)作業(yè)得到全部結(jié)果而執(zhí)行結(jié)束時(shí)再行輸出。這樣在執(zhí)行過(guò)程中,不需要使用輸入機(jī)和打印機(jī)。因此在配置一臺(tái)輸入機(jī)和打印機(jī)的情況下,可以讓多個(gè)作業(yè)同時(shí)執(zhí)行,并且各個(gè)作業(yè)請(qǐng)求輸入信息和輸出結(jié)果的要求都能及時(shí)得到滿足和實(shí)現(xiàn)。

  4、SPOOL系統(tǒng)的組成和實(shí)現(xiàn):

  井:為實(shí)現(xiàn)虛擬設(shè)備在磁盤上劃出的專用存儲(chǔ)空間,用于存放作業(yè)的初始信息和執(zhí)行結(jié)果。

  SPOOL系統(tǒng)由三部分程序組成:

  1、預(yù)輸入程序。通過(guò)該程序把作業(yè)流中每個(gè)作業(yè)的初始信息傳送到輸入井保存,以備作業(yè)執(zhí)行時(shí)使用。

  2、井管理程序:根據(jù)作業(yè)的請(qǐng)求,保證作業(yè)正確及時(shí)地從“井”中讀取或?qū)懗鲂畔ⅰ?/P>

  3、緩輸出程序。它負(fù)責(zé)查看“輸出井”中是否有待輸出的結(jié)果信息,若有則啟動(dòng)打印機(jī)把作業(yè)結(jié)果輸出。

  4、spool系統(tǒng)可以縮短作業(yè)執(zhí)行時(shí)間的原因。

  作業(yè)的執(zhí)行時(shí)間是指作業(yè)被裝入主存儲(chǔ)器到產(chǎn)生全部結(jié)果所需要的時(shí)間。在SP在SPOOL系統(tǒng)控制下,作業(yè)執(zhí)行時(shí)從磁盤上讀/寫信息代替低速的輸入機(jī)和打印機(jī)的讀/寫操作,信息傳送的速率顯然是快得多。因此作業(yè)的執(zhí)行時(shí)間就縮短了。

文章搜索
萬(wàn)題庫(kù)小程序
萬(wàn)題庫(kù)小程序
·章節(jié)視頻 ·章節(jié)練習(xí)
·免費(fèi)真題 ·?荚囶}
微信掃碼,立即獲!
掃碼免費(fèi)使用
大學(xué)語(yǔ)文
共計(jì)461課時(shí)
講義已上傳
18020人在學(xué)
管理系統(tǒng)中計(jì)算機(jī)應(yīng)用
共計(jì)21課時(shí)
講義已上傳
7218人在學(xué)
政治經(jīng)濟(jì)學(xué)(財(cái)經(jīng)類)
共計(jì)738課時(shí)
講義已上傳
87485人在學(xué)
經(jīng)濟(jì)法概論(財(cái)經(jīng)類)
共計(jì)21課時(shí)
講義已上傳
989人在學(xué)
毛概
共計(jì)269課時(shí)
講義已上傳
16493人在學(xué)
推薦使用萬(wàn)題庫(kù)APP學(xué)習(xí)
掃一掃,下載萬(wàn)題庫(kù)
手機(jī)學(xué)習(xí),復(fù)習(xí)效率提升50%!
版權(quán)聲明:如果自學(xué)考試網(wǎng)所轉(zhuǎn)載內(nèi)容不慎侵犯了您的權(quán)益,請(qǐng)與我們聯(lián)系800@exam8.com,我們將會(huì)及時(shí)處理。如轉(zhuǎn)載本自學(xué)考試網(wǎng)內(nèi)容,請(qǐng)注明出處。
官方
微信
掃描關(guān)注自考微信
領(lǐng)《大數(shù)據(jù)寶典》
報(bào)名
查分
掃描二維碼
關(guān)注自考報(bào)名查分
看直播 下載
APP
下載萬(wàn)題庫(kù)
領(lǐng)精選6套卷
萬(wàn)題庫(kù)
微信小程序
幫助
中心
文章責(zé)編:wuxiaojuan825